60-34 CATALPA AVENUE
60-34 CATALPA AVENUE is a Class B1 (two-family brick) building in Queens (BBL 4035150017) built in 1909, with 2 residential units.
The current registered owner of record per NYC PLUTO is VOGEL, ROSE H.
The most recent ACRIS deed transfer for this BBL was recorded on March 3, 2026 when KOHRS, LINDA conveyed the property to KOHRS, LINDA H; KOHRS, ARTHUR F for a non-disclosed consideration. The transaction was recorded as cash (no paired mortgage instrument).
